You're locked out of your car
If you are locked out of your vehicle, it's crucial to stay calm and think clearly. It's easy for you to panic or get worked up, but this won't aid in finding an answer. You could cause more damage to your vehicle by trying to get into it using wire hooks or wedges. This will cost you more over time. Luckily, professional auto locksmiths are specially trained to utilize tools to unlock cars without creating any damage. They have access to specialist locks and keys that aren't accessible to the general public. This permits them to unlock a variety of vehicle models.
If you are able, move to a safe location before calling for assistance. If you are unable to do so, call roadside assistance and request them to send out locksmiths. Be aware that this service is a claim against your insurance policy on your vehicle, and it could impact your no-claims bonus. If your insurance policy does not cover this service or even if AAA membership is not available, locate a locksmith that is specialized in your car. Modern cars have complex locking systems. You should make sure that the locksmith you select is familiar with the model you have.

Lock Rekeying
Locksmiths are skilled tradesperson that works with keys and locks of all kinds. Locksmiths can be hired to open vehicles, repair damaged door locks, and even install security systems in homes and businesses. They also offer a variety of other services, including key cutting, rekeying and key programming. Although many locksmiths do not have formal qualifications, they often learn on the job or during an apprenticeship. Many locksmiths are also members of professional associations that promote ethics in the industry.
A reputable locksmith will always give transparent prices and quotes for their services. They will also be fully insured, so that in the event of damage occurs to your windows or doors they will cover the damage. Locksmiths will also have all the tools they need to complete their task quickly, without causing damage to existing windows or locks.
The most important task of a locksmith is to help those who have lost their car keys or have them stolen. In these cases, locksmiths can cut replacement keys right on the spot. They can also reprogram keyless remotes or VATS passcode detectors, if they are fitted to your vehicle.
Some locksmiths can even change the locks' keys to ensure that the keys you have previously used are not used to gain entry into your business or home. This is a less expensive alternative to replace all of your locks, and will still give you the same level of security. A good locksmith will be able to rekey any type of lock in a matter of minutes.
